Monserrate Palace and Gardens: A Sanctuary in Sintra

Monserrate-Palace-Sintra

Nestled in the picturesque town of Sintra, just a short drive from Lisbon, lies the magnificent Monserrate Palace. This stunning palace is a must-visit for any traveler looking to immerse themselves in the rich history and culture of Portugal. With its intricate architecture, lush gardens, and breathtaking views, Monserrate Palace is a true gem of the region.

History and Facts:

The history of Monserrate Palace dates back to the 16th century when it was originally a small chapel dedicated to Our Lady of Monserrate. It wasn’t until the 19th century that the palace was transformed into the grandiose structure that we see today. The palace was commissioned by Sir Francis Cook, an English businessman who fell in love with the beauty of Sintra and decided to make it his home.

The construction of the palace took over 30 years and was completed in 1858. The design of the palace is a blend of Gothic, Moorish, and Indian styles, making it a unique and eclectic masterpiece. The interior of the palace is just as impressive, with intricate details and luxurious furnishings that showcase the wealth and opulence of its former owners.

Things to Visit Inside:

As you enter Monserrate Palace, you will be greeted by the grand entrance hall, adorned with beautiful tiles and intricate carvings. From there, you can explore the various rooms of the palace, each with its own unique style and charm.

One of the highlights of the palace is the Music Room, with its stunning stained glass windows and ornate ceiling. This room was used for concerts and gatherings, and it’s not hard to imagine the grandeur of such events in this lavish setting.

Another must-see room is the Dining Room, with its impressive table that can seat up to 40 guests. The walls are covered in beautiful silk tapestries, and the ceiling is adorned with intricate paintings and chandeliers.

The Drawing Room is another favorite among visitors, with its stunning views of the surrounding gardens and the Atlantic Ocean. This room was used as a place for relaxation and contemplation, and it’s easy to see why with its peaceful atmosphere and breathtaking views.

The palace also has a chapel, which is still used for religious ceremonies today. The chapel is a beautiful example of Gothic architecture, with its intricate details and stunning stained glass windows.

Opening Times and Admission Prices:

Monserrate Palace is open to visitors all year round, with the exception of Christmas Day and New Year’s Day. The opening hours vary depending on the season, so it’s best to check the official website for the most up-to-date information.

The admission prices for Monserrate Palace are very reasonable, with adult tickets costing €8.50 and children under 18 entering for free. There are also discounts available for seniors, students, and families.
